72 /*
73  * This file implements the full-compatibility mode of make, which makes the
74  * targets without parallelism and without a custom shell.
75  *
76  * Interface:
77  *        Compat_MakeAll      Initialize this module and make the given targets.
78  */
79 
80 #ifdef HAVE_CONFIG_H
81 # include   "config.h"
82 #endif
83 #include <sys/types.h>
84 #include <sys/stat.h>
85 #include "wait.h"
86 
87 #include <errno.h>
88 #include <signal.h>
89 
90 #include "make.h"
91 #include "dir.h"
92 #include "job.h"
93 #include "metachar.h"
94 #include "pathnames.h"
95 
96 /*        "@(#)compat.c       8.2 (Berkeley) 3/19/94"       */
97 MAKE_RCSID("$NetBSD: compat.c,v 1.241 2022/08/17 20:10:29 rillig Exp $");
98 
99 static GNode *curTarg = NULL;
100 static pid_t compatChild;
101 static int compatSigno;
102 
103 /*
104  * CompatDeleteTarget -- delete the file of a failed, interrupted, or
105  * otherwise duffed target if not inhibited by .PRECIOUS.
106  */
107 static void
CompatDeleteTarget(GNode * gn)108 CompatDeleteTarget(GNode *gn)
109 {
110           if (gn != NULL && !GNode_IsPrecious(gn)) {
111                     const char *file = GNode_VarTarget(gn);
112 
113                     if (!opts.noExecute && unlink_file(file)) {
114                               Error("*** %s removed", file);
115                     }
116           }
117 }
118 
119 /*
120  * Interrupt the creation of the current target and remove it if it ain't
121  * precious. Then exit.
122  *
123  * If .INTERRUPT exists, its commands are run first WITH INTERRUPTS IGNORED.
124  *
125  * XXX: is .PRECIOUS supposed to inhibit .INTERRUPT? I doubt it, but I've
126  * left the logic alone for now. - dholland 20160826
127  */
128 static void
CompatInterrupt(int signo)129 CompatInterrupt(int signo)
130 {
131           CompatDeleteTarget(curTarg);
132 
133           if (curTarg != NULL && !GNode_IsPrecious(curTarg)) {
134                     /*
135                      * Run .INTERRUPT only if hit with interrupt signal
136                      */
137                     if (signo == SIGINT) {
138                               GNode *gn = Targ_FindNode(".INTERRUPT");
139                               if (gn != NULL) {
140                                         Compat_Make(gn, gn);
141                               }
142                     }
143           }
144 
145           if (signo == SIGQUIT)
146                     _exit(signo);
147 
148           /*
149            * If there is a child running, pass the signal on.
150            * We will exist after it has exited.
151            */
152           compatSigno = signo;
153           if (compatChild > 0) {
154                     KILLPG(compatChild, signo);
155           } else {
156                     bmake_signal(signo, SIG_DFL);
157                     kill(myPid, signo);
158           }
159 }
160 
161 static void
DebugFailedTarget(const char * cmd,const GNode * gn)162 DebugFailedTarget(const char *cmd, const GNode *gn)
163 {
164           const char *p = cmd;
165           debug_printf("\n*** Failed target:  %s\n*** Failed command: ",
166               gn->name);
167 
168           /*
169            * Replace runs of whitespace with a single space, to reduce the
170            * amount of whitespace for multi-line command lines.
171            */
172           while (*p != '\0') {
173                     if (ch_isspace(*p)) {
174                               debug_printf(" ");
175                               cpp_skip_whitespace(&p);
176                     } else {
177                               debug_printf("%c", *p);
178                               p++;
179                     }
180           }
181           debug_printf("\n");
182 }
183 
184 static bool
UseShell(const char * cmd MAKE_ATTR_UNUSED)185 UseShell(const char *cmd MAKE_ATTR_UNUSED)
186 {
187 #if defined(FORCE_USE_SHELL) || !defined(MAKE_NATIVE)
188           /*
189            * In a non-native build, the host environment might be weird enough
190            * that it's necessary to go through a shell to get the correct
191            * behaviour.  Or perhaps the shell has been replaced with something
192            * that does extra logging, and that should not be bypassed.
193            */
194           return true;
195 #else
196           /*
197            * Search for meta characters in the command. If there are no meta
198            * characters, there's no need to execute a shell to execute the
199            * command.
200            *
201            * Additionally variable assignments and empty commands
202            * go to the shell. Therefore treat '=' and ':' like shell
203            * meta characters as documented in make(1).
204            */
205 
206           return needshell(cmd);
207 #endif
208 }

210 /*
211  * Execute the next command for a target. If the command returns an error,
212  * the node's made field is set to ERROR and creation stops.
213  *
214  * Input:
215  *        cmdp                Command to execute
216  *        gn                  Node from which the command came
217  *        ln                  List node that contains the command
218  *
219  * Results:
220  *        true if the command succeeded.
221  */
222 bool
Compat_RunCommand(const char * cmdp,GNode * gn,StringListNode * ln)223 Compat_RunCommand(const char *cmdp, GNode *gn, StringListNode *ln)
224 {
225           char *cmdStart;               /* Start of expanded command */
226           char *bp;
227           bool silent;                  /* Don't print command */
228           bool doIt;                    /* Execute even if -n */
229           volatile bool errCheck;       /* Check errors */
230           WAIT_T reason;                /* Reason for child's death */
231           WAIT_T status;                /* Description of child's death */
232           pid_t cpid;                   /* Child actually found */
233           pid_t retstat;                /* Result of wait */
234           const char **volatile av; /* Argument vector for thing to exec */
235           char **volatile mav;          /* Copy of the argument vector for freeing */
236           bool useShell;                /* True if command should be executed using a
237                                          * shell */
238           const char *volatile cmd = cmdp;
239 
240           silent = (gn->type & OP_SILENT) != OP_NONE;
241           errCheck = !(gn->type & OP_IGNORE);
242           doIt = false;
243 
244           (void)Var_Subst(cmd, gn, VARE_WANTRES, &cmdStart);
245           /* TODO: handle errors */
246 
247           if (cmdStart[0] == '\0') {
248                     free(cmdStart);
249                     return true;
250           }
251           cmd = cmdStart;
252           LstNode_Set(ln, cmdStart);
253 
254           if (gn->type & OP_SAVE_CMDS) {
255                     GNode *endNode = Targ_GetEndNode();
256                     if (gn != endNode) {
257                               /*
258                                * Append the expanded command, to prevent the
259                                * local variables from being interpreted in the
260                                * scope of the .END node.
261                                *
262                                * A probably unintended side effect of this is that
263                                * the expanded command will be expanded again in the
264                                * .END node.  Therefore, a literal '$' in these
265                                * commands must be written as '$$$$' instead of the
266                                * usual '$$'.
267                                */
268                               Lst_Append(&endNode->commands, cmdStart);
269                               return true;
270                     }
271           }
272           if (strcmp(cmdStart, "...") == 0) {
273                     gn->type |= OP_SAVE_CMDS;
274                     return true;
275           }
276 
277           for (;;) {
278                     if (*cmd == '@')
279                               silent = !DEBUG(LOUD);
280                     else if (*cmd == '-')
281                               errCheck = false;
282                     else if (*cmd == '+') {
283                               doIt = true;
284                               if (shellName == NULL)        /* we came here from jobs */
285                                         Shell_Init();
286                     } else
287                               break;
288                     cmd++;
289           }
290 
291           while (ch_isspace(*cmd))
292                     cmd++;
293 
294           /*
295            * If we did not end up with a command, just skip it.
296            */
297           if (cmd[0] == '\0')
298                     return true;
299 
300           useShell = UseShell(cmd);
301           /*
302            * Print the command before echoing if we're not supposed to be quiet
303            * for this one. We also print the command if -n given.
304            */
305           if (!silent || !GNode_ShouldExecute(gn)) {
306                     printf("%s\n", cmd);
307                     fflush(stdout);
308           }
309 
310           /*
311            * If we're not supposed to execute any commands, this is as far as
312            * we go...
313            */
314           if (!doIt && !GNode_ShouldExecute(gn))
315                     return true;
316 
317           DEBUG1(JOB, "Execute: '%s'\n", cmd);
318 
319           if (useShell) {
320                     /*
321                      * We need to pass the command off to the shell, typically
322                      * because the command contains a "meta" character.
323                      */
324                     static const char *shargv[5];
325 
326                     /* The following work for any of the builtin shell specs. */
327                     int shargc = 0;
328                     shargv[shargc++] = shellPath;
329                     if (errCheck && shellErrFlag != NULL)
330                               shargv[shargc++] = shellErrFlag;
331                     shargv[shargc++] = DEBUG(SHELL) ? "-xc" : "-c";
332                     shargv[shargc++] = cmd;
333                     shargv[shargc] = NULL;
334                     av = shargv;
335                     bp = NULL;
336                     mav = NULL;
337           } else {
338                     /*
339                      * No meta-characters, so no need to exec a shell. Break the
340                      * command into words to form an argument vector we can
341                      * execute.
342                      */
343                     Words words = Str_Words(cmd, false);
344                     mav = words.words;
345                     bp = words.freeIt;
346                     av = (void *)mav;
347           }
348 
349 #ifdef USE_META
350           if (useMeta)
351                     meta_compat_start();
352 #endif
353 
354           Var_ReexportVars();
355 
356           compatChild = cpid = vfork();
357           if (cpid < 0)
358                     Fatal("Could not fork");
359 
360           if (cpid == 0) {
361 #ifdef USE_META
362                     if (useMeta)
363                               meta_compat_child();
364 #endif
365                     (void)execvp(av[0], (char *const *)UNCONST(av));
366                     execDie("exec", av[0]);
367           }
368 
369           free(mav);
370           free(bp);
371 
372           /* XXX: Memory management looks suspicious here. */
373           /* XXX: Setting a list item to NULL is unexpected. */
374           LstNode_SetNull(ln);
375 
376 #ifdef USE_META
377           if (useMeta)
378                     meta_compat_parent(cpid);
379 #endif
380 
381           /*
382            * The child is off and running. Now all we can do is wait...
383            */
384           while ((retstat = wait(&reason)) != cpid) {
385                     if (retstat > 0)
386                               JobReapChild(retstat, reason, false); /* not ours? */
387                     if (retstat == -1 && errno != EINTR) {
388                               break;
389                     }
390           }
391 
392           if (retstat < 0)
393                     Fatal("error in wait: %d: %s", retstat, strerror(errno));
394 
395           if (WIFSTOPPED(reason)) {
396                     status = WSTOPSIG(reason);    /* stopped */
397           } else if (WIFEXITED(reason)) {
398                     status = WEXITSTATUS(reason); /* exited */
399 #if defined(USE_META) && defined(USE_FILEMON_ONCE)
400                     if (useMeta)
401                               meta_cmd_finish(NULL);
402 #endif
403                     if (status != 0) {
404                               if (DEBUG(ERROR))
405                                         DebugFailedTarget(cmd, gn);
406                               printf("*** Error code %d", status);
407                     }
408           } else {
409                     status = WTERMSIG(reason);    /* signaled */
410                     printf("*** Signal %d", status);
411           }
412 
413 
414           if (!WIFEXITED(reason) || status != 0) {
415                     if (errCheck) {
416 #ifdef USE_META
417                               if (useMeta)
418                                         meta_job_error(NULL, gn, false, status);
419 #endif
420                               gn->made = ERROR;
421                               if (opts.keepgoing) {
422                                         /*
423                                          * Abort the current target,
424                                          * but let others continue.
425                                          */
426                                         printf(" (continuing)\n");
427                               } else {
428                                         printf("\n");
429                               }
430                               if (deleteOnError)
431                                         CompatDeleteTarget(gn);
432                     } else {
433                               /*
434                                * Continue executing commands for this target.
435                                * If we return 0, this will happen...
436                                */
437                               printf(" (ignored)\n");
438                               status = 0;
439                     }
440           }
441 
442           free(cmdStart);
443           compatChild = 0;
444           if (compatSigno != 0) {
445                     bmake_signal(compatSigno, SIG_DFL);
446                     kill(myPid, compatSigno);
447           }
448 
449           return status == 0;
450 }

527 static bool
MakeUnmade(GNode * gn,GNode * pgn)528 MakeUnmade(GNode *gn, GNode *pgn)
529 {
530 
531           assert(gn->made == UNMADE);
532 
533           /*
534            * First mark ourselves to be made, then apply whatever transformations
535            * the suffix module thinks are necessary. Once that's done, we can
536            * descend and make all our children. If any of them has an error
537            * but the -k flag was given, our 'make' field will be set to false
538            * again. This is our signal to not attempt to do anything but abort
539            * our parent as well.
540            */
541           gn->flags.remake = true;
542           gn->made = BEINGMADE;
543 
544           if (!(gn->type & OP_MADE))
545                     Suff_FindDeps(gn);
546 
547           MakeNodes(&gn->children, gn);
548 
549           if (!gn->flags.remake) {
550                     gn->made = ABORTED;
551                     pgn->flags.remake = false;
552                     return false;
553           }
554 
555           if (Lst_FindDatum(&gn->implicitParents, pgn) != NULL)
556                     Var_Set(pgn, IMPSRC, GNode_VarTarget(gn));
557 
558           /*
559            * All the children were made ok. Now youngestChild->mtime contains the
560            * modification time of the newest child, we need to find out if we
561            * exist and when we were modified last. The criteria for datedness
562            * are defined by GNode_IsOODate.
563            */
564           DEBUG1(MAKE, "Examining %s...", gn->name);
565           if (!GNode_IsOODate(gn)) {
566                     gn->made = UPTODATE;
567                     DEBUG0(MAKE, "up-to-date.\n");
568                     return false;
569           }
570 
571           /*
572            * If the user is just seeing if something is out-of-date, exit now
573            * to tell him/her "yes".
574            */
575           DEBUG0(MAKE, "out-of-date.\n");
576           if (opts.query && gn != Targ_GetEndNode())
577                     exit(1);
578 
579           /*
580            * We need to be re-made.
581            * Ensure that $? (.OODATE) and $> (.ALLSRC) are both set.
582            */
583           GNode_SetLocalVars(gn);
584 
585           /*
586            * Alter our type to tell if errors should be ignored or things
587            * should not be printed so Compat_RunCommand knows what to do.
588            */
589           if (opts.ignoreErrors)
590                     gn->type |= OP_IGNORE;
591           if (opts.silent)
592                     gn->type |= OP_SILENT;
593 
594           if (Job_CheckCommands(gn, Fatal)) {
595                     /*
596                      * Our commands are ok, but we still have to worry about
597                      * the -t flag.
598                      */
599                     if (!opts.touch || (gn->type & OP_MAKE)) {
600                               curTarg = gn;
601 #ifdef USE_META
602                               if (useMeta && GNode_ShouldExecute(gn))
603                                         meta_job_start(NULL, gn);
604 #endif
605                               RunCommands(gn);
606                               curTarg = NULL;
607                     } else {
608                               Job_Touch(gn, (gn->type & OP_SILENT) != OP_NONE);
609                     }
610           } else {
611                     gn->made = ERROR;
612           }
613 #ifdef USE_META
614           if (useMeta && GNode_ShouldExecute(gn)) {
615                     if (meta_job_finish(NULL) != 0)
616                               gn->made = ERROR;
617           }
618 #endif
619 
620           if (gn->made != ERROR) {
621                     /*
622                      * If the node was made successfully, mark it so, update
623                      * its modification time and timestamp all its parents.
624                      * This is to keep its state from affecting that of its parent.
625                      */
626                     gn->made = MADE;
627                     if (Make_Recheck(gn) == 0)
628                               pgn->flags.force = true;
629                     if (!(gn->type & OP_EXEC)) {
630                               pgn->flags.childMade = true;
631                               GNode_UpdateYoungestChild(pgn, gn);
632                     }
633           } else if (opts.keepgoing) {
634                     pgn->flags.remake = false;
635           } else {
636                     PrintOnError(gn, "\nStop.\n");
637                     exit(1);
638           }
639           return true;
640 }
641 
642 static void
MakeOther(GNode * gn,GNode * pgn)643 MakeOther(GNode *gn, GNode *pgn)
644 {
645 
646           if (Lst_FindDatum(&gn->implicitParents, pgn) != NULL) {
647                     const char *target = GNode_VarTarget(gn);
648                     Var_Set(pgn, IMPSRC, target != NULL ? target : "");
649           }
650 
651           switch (gn->made) {
652           case BEINGMADE:
653                     Error("Graph cycles through %s", gn->name);
654                     gn->made = ERROR;
655                     pgn->flags.remake = false;
656                     break;
657           case MADE:
658                     if (!(gn->type & OP_EXEC)) {
659                               pgn->flags.childMade = true;
660                               GNode_UpdateYoungestChild(pgn, gn);
661                     }
662                     break;
663           case UPTODATE:
664                     if (!(gn->type & OP_EXEC))
665                               GNode_UpdateYoungestChild(pgn, gn);
666                     break;
667           default:
668                     break;
669           }
670 }
671 
672 /*
673  * Make a target.
674  *
675  * If an error is detected and not being ignored, the process exits.
676  *
677  * Input:
678  *        gn                  The node to make
679  *        pgn                 Parent to abort if necessary
680  *
681  * Output:
682  *        gn->made
683  *                  UPTODATE  gn was already up-to-date.
684  *                  MADE                gn was recreated successfully.
685  *                  ERROR               An error occurred while gn was being created,
686  *                                      either due to missing commands or in -k mode.
687  *                  ABORTED             gn was not remade because one of its
688  *                                      dependencies could not be made due to errors.
689  */
690 void
Compat_Make(GNode * gn,GNode * pgn)691 Compat_Make(GNode *gn, GNode *pgn)
692 {
693           if (shellName == NULL)        /* we came here from jobs */
694                     Shell_Init();
695 
696           if (gn->made == UNMADE && (gn == pgn || !(pgn->type & OP_MADE))) {
697                     if (!MakeUnmade(gn, pgn))
698                               goto cohorts;
699 
700                     /* XXX: Replace with GNode_IsError(gn) */
701           } else if (gn->made == ERROR) {
702                     /*
703                      * Already had an error when making this.
704                      * Tell the parent to abort.
705                      */
706                     pgn->flags.remake = false;
707           } else {
708                     MakeOther(gn, pgn);
709           }
710 
711 cohorts:
712           MakeNodes(&gn->cohorts, pgn);
713 }

742 void
Compat_MakeAll(GNodeList * targs)743 Compat_MakeAll(GNodeList *targs)
744 {
745           GNode *errorNode = NULL;
746 
747           if (shellName == NULL)
748                     Shell_Init();
749 
750           InitSignals();
751 
752           /*
753            * Create the .END node now, to keep the (debug) output of the
754            * counter.mk test the same as before 2020-09-23.  This
755            * implementation detail probably doesn't matter though.
756            */
757           (void)Targ_GetEndNode();
758 
759           if (!opts.query)
760                     MakeBeginNode();
761 
762           /*
763            * Expand .USE nodes right now, because they can modify the structure
764            * of the tree.
765            */
766           Make_ExpandUse(targs);
767 
768           while (!Lst_IsEmpty(targs)) {
769                     GNode *gn = Lst_Dequeue(targs);
770                     Compat_Make(gn, gn);
771 
772                     if (gn->made == UPTODATE) {
773                               printf("`%s' is up to date.\n", gn->name);
774                     } else if (gn->made == ABORTED) {
775                               printf("`%s' not remade because of errors.\n",
776                                   gn->name);
777                     }
778                     if (GNode_IsError(gn) && errorNode == NULL)
779                               errorNode = gn;
780           }
781 
782           /* If the user has defined a .END target, run its commands. */
783           if (errorNode == NULL) {
784                     GNode *endNode = Targ_GetEndNode();
785                     Compat_Make(endNode, endNode);
786                     if (GNode_IsError(endNode))
787                               errorNode = endNode;
788           }
789 
790           if (errorNode != NULL) {
791                     if (DEBUG(GRAPH2))
792                               Targ_PrintGraph(2);
793                     else if (DEBUG(GRAPH3))
794                               Targ_PrintGraph(3);
795                     PrintOnError(errorNode, "\nStop.\n");
796                     exit(1);
797           }
798 }
